Which types of pharmacy technicians can prepare and affix labels to prescriptions?

  1. Only certified technicians

  2. Only registered technicians

  3. All three types of technicians

  4. Only trainee technicians

The correct answer is: All three types of technicians

In Ohio, all pharmacy technicians, regardless of their certification status or level of training, can prepare and affix labels to prescriptions as part of their duties. This includes certified technicians, registered technicians, and trainee technicians. The role of affixing labels is considered a fundamental task within the pharmacy setting, essential for ensuring that medications are accurately dispensed and correctly identified for patients. The law operates under the principle that as long as the pharmacy technician is supervised by a licensed pharmacist, they can perform this function. The classification of technician (whether certified, registered, or in training) does not restrict the ability to engage in this specific task.
